TL;DR
Senior Product Quality Engineer (Aerospace/Defense): Managing product quality for complex electro-mechanical assemblies from design through production with an accent on nonconformance investigations, corrective actions, audits, and regulatory compliance. Focus on developing quality metrics, driving production readiness, investigating field issues, and coordinating quality requirements across engineering, manufacturing, suppliers, and customers.

Location: Torrance, California, United States. Travel up to 10% may be required. ITAR eligibility is required: U.S. citizenship or nationality, U.S. lawful permanent residency, refugee or asylee status, or eligibility to obtain the required authorizations.

Salary: $113,600–$130,800 USD per year for roles hired in California.

Company

hirify.global is a high-growth defense technology company developing Leonidas, a software-defined system based on intelligent power management for national security applications.

What you will do

  • Develop and maintain quality assurance processes, plans, and procedures aligned with AS9100, customer, and internal quality management system requirements.
  • Lead nonconformance investigations, corrective actions, root cause analysis, MRB activities, audits, and inspection and test capability analysis.
  • Drive advanced quality practices and production-readiness activities throughout product development.
  • Manage field quality issues, failure investigations, customer communication, and corrective-action closure.
  • Partner with engineering, manufacturing, supply chain, and suppliers to identify risks and improve product quality and reliability.
  • Develop quality dashboards and trend analysis, and support qualification, FAI, verification, validation, audits, and customer reporting.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in manufacturing, mechanical, electrical, industrial engineering, or a related field.
  • 5+ years of quality, manufacturing, or engineering experience in aerospace, defense, regulated, high-reliability, or complex commercial electronics environments.
  • Knowledge of GD&T, design review, configuration management, and quality management for complex electro-mechanical assemblies.
  • Experience managing MRB nonconformances, corrective actions, customer or program quality requirements, and quality flowdowns.
  • Knowledge of ISO 9001, AS9100, or similar quality management system standards.
  • Must meet ITAR eligibility requirements for work in the United States.

Nice to have

  • ASQ CQE, Certified Auditor, Lean Six Sigma, or IPC certifications.
  • Experience with Oracle ERP, QMS software, APQP, PPAP, Control Plans, PFMEA, and Measurement Capability Analysis.
  • Experience with aerospace and defense electromechanical assemblies, IPC and MIL-STD specifications, reliability engineering, qualification testing, and failure analysis.
  • Experience with Excel, Tableau, Power BI, or similar data analysis and visualization tools.
  • Startup or high-growth experience scaling quality processes.
